Dr. C. C. Wallén 《Pure and Applied Geophysics》1950,18(1):175-178
Summary A review is given of the investigations on variations in the general circulation in middle latitudes made byWillett andPetterssen. According toWillett a «high-index» type of circulation pattern with a strong zonal flow has probably caused the recent climatic improvement in the northern latitudes while the «low-index» type with meridional flow would create a cooling off in the same areas. According toPetterssen an other type of «low-index» pattern with a weak zonal flow and strong meridional exchange of air has been the essential cause of the warming up of the northern latitudes in Europe. This implies that the definition of the «low-index» type is not clear and gives rise to misunderstanding. Making use of our experience on glacier retreat in northern Scandinavia it is concluded that thePetterssen type of circulation more probably than the «high-index» type has caused the warming-up in the North Atlantic area from which the retreat of the glaciers has followed. 相似文献

Dr. R. A. Hirvonen 《Pure and Applied Geophysics》1950,18(1):103-106
Summary The recording of the contact times of a solar eclipse on two stations provides a geodetic measurement of the arc between the stations. The applications of this idea hitherto undertaken and the relevant apparature are briefly summarized. Some experiences obtained at the measuring of the records and at the computing of the results are described. 相似文献

Dr. H. Arakawa 《Pure and Applied Geophysics》1951,20(1):56-61
Summary Many writers treated on the problem of dynamic instability of westerly flow due to the excessive horizontal shear, and the present author discusses the corresponding dynamic instability due to the vertical shear. The critical vertical shear in indifferent stratification is given by the condition — the meridional component of absolute vorticity vanishes, — and is an approximate negative valueof 10–4
sec
–1 in middle latitude. However the critical vertical shear in normal stable stratification is a fairly large negative value of 2 sec–1. It might be emphasized that the problem of this study differs fromRichardson's criterion of turbulence, for the present author discusses the condition under which the zonal flow is dynamically stable, whileRichardson expressed the condition under which the turbulence will decrease. 相似文献

Dr. Carlo Bernasconi 《Pure and Applied Geophysics》1951,19(1-2):39-43
Riassunto Per rappresentare una curva spaziale su un piano si può piegare un filo metallico secondo la curva e fotografarlo, operazione che però richiede molto tempo. Nel presente articolo l'A. illustra un dispositivo ottico che, sostituito alla matita della tavola di egresso della macchina diBush, è atto a descrivere su pellicola una curva simile all'immagine fotografica del filo. In questo studio si sono considerati soltanto i casi in cui la sorgente di luce che illumina la è all'infinito o nella origine delle coordinate, mentre il punto di vista à sempre all'infinito.
Summary One may represent a spatial curve on a plane by bending a metal thread along the curve and then photographing it, but in this way much time is wasted. In the present paper the A. suggests an optical device which, replaced to the pencil of the out-put table ofBush's machine, traces on film a curve that should look like the photographic image of the thread. In this study were taken into account only the cases in which the light source lighting , is at the infinite or in the coordinate origin, while the point of view is always at the infinite.相似文献

Prof. Dr. A. Berroth 《Pure and Applied Geophysics》1951,19(3-4):117-123
Summary The gravitational declination appears here as the analogue of the wellknown magnetic declination. The photographic recording theodolit in connection with a high frequency impulse transmitter allows, by a method of simultaneousness on two fieldstations, its direct and connected measurement and its elimination with regard to geodetic directions. The method has been based on linear equations, with the only request of horizontal angle measurements to a plain system of stars, abstracting from any transportable clocks. The method promises a higher accuracy and a multiple as great working velocity, comparatively to the state at present.
